How Can Players Manage Their Device’S Performance While Gaming on Kingdom Casino?
To optimize our device’s performance while gaming on Kingdom Casino, let’s enhance device settings by closing background apps and refreshing software regularly. Decreasing screen brightness and deactivating non-essential notifications can also help. Performance recommendations like using Wi-Fi instead of mobile data and securing sufficient device storage can improve gaming efficiency. By centering on these methods, we can preserve optimal gameplay, reducing lag and ensuring a uninterrupted gaming experience.
